Whatever you think of the peace symbol--inspiring, cheesy, ubiquitous--you have to admit the history is pretty incredible. Or if you're not sure that it's pretty incredible, check out
Peace: The Biography of a Symbol, peace activist Ken Kolsbun's brand new tome which is deserving of a nice spot right at the center of the coffee table.
The book uses words, artwork and stunning photos to tell the story of the symbol that launched a movement, defined a generation, and now looks cute on pendants, baby hats and backpacks everywhere.
